The U.S. Department of Transportation (U.S. DOT) and its research partners will be offering a live demonstration of connected vehicle safety technology at the Alameda Naval Air Station.  During the demonstration participants will be able to experience the cars in action, witness how wireless-based safety communications help prevent crashes, speak one-on-one with the government and industry researchers, and learn how connected vehicles will change the future of automobile safety.

Connected vehicle research is a multimodal initiative that enables safe, interoperable, networked wireless communication among vehicles, infrastructure, and other communications devices. The U.S. DOT is working with car companies, trucking firms, local communities, academia, and high technology firms on this significant life saving research initiative.  Don’t miss your chance to ride in these state-of-the-art, safety-equipped vehicles and  become part of the future of surface transportation

The Connected Vehicle Demonstration is a partnership between the U.S. DOT and the Crash Avoidance Metrics Partnership (CAMP), which includes Ford, General Motors, Honda, Hyundai/ KIA, Mercedes-Benz, Nissan, Toyota, and the Volkswagen Group of America.
